The Torquay Herald Express of April 27th 2009 ran the headline ‘Cemetery praise from past protestor’. It went on: “The look of Torquay cemetery has been praised by one of its fiercest critics from the past. Trevor Parnell made the headlines five years ago when he launched a protest campaign against the council. Trevor’s late father, Fred, is buried at the Hele Road cemetery which is now run for the council by management company Westerleigh. Trevor has noticed a huge improvement. He says: “They have done a brilliant job since taking over. The grass is cut, the place is looking so nice. I just want to say a big thank you to them”.
